.indexlogo[data-v-34444dd2]{object-fit:contain;cursor:pointer;margin-left:2%;margin-right:2%;float:left;width:175px;height:55px;margin-top:3px}.header[data-v-34444dd2]{position:fixed;top:0;width:100%;text-align:center;z-index:999;height:60px;background-color:rgba(0,0,0,.3);box-shadow:0 4px 6px rgba(0,0,0,.1)}.header.sticky[data-v-34444dd2]{background-color:transparent;box-shadow:none}.logo[data-v-34444dd2]{width:100%;height:100%}.userinfo[data-v-34444dd2]{color:#fff;font-size:16px;margin-right:20px;cursor:pointer;line-height:60px}.userinfo .avatar[data-v-34444dd2]{margin-right:15px}.login-button[data-v-34444dd2]{line-height:60px;color:#fff;font-size:14px;margin-right:28px;cursor:pointer;border:1px solid #fff;padding:10px;border-radius:10px}[data-v-34444dd2] .el-menu--horizontal>.el-menu-item.is-active{border-bottom:none}[data-v-34444dd2] .el-menu.el-menu--horizontal{border-bottom:none;background-color:transparent}.el-menu--horizontal>.el-menu-item[data-v-34444dd2]:not(.is-disabled):hover,.el-menu--horizontal>.el-submenu .el-submenu__title[data-v-34444dd2]:hover,[data-v-34444dd2] .el-menu--horizontal>.el-menu-item:not(.is-disabled):focus{background-color:transparent;opacity:.8}[data-v-34444dd2] .el-menu-item{font-size:16px}[data-v-34444dd2] .el-submenu--horizontal{border-bottom:none;background-color:transparent;font-size:16px}[data-v-34444dd2] .el-link.el-link--default:hover{color:#fff}.popover-wrapper[data-v-34444dd2]{padding:5px}.popover-content .content-item[data-v-34444dd2]{border-top:1px solid hsla(0,0%,50.2%,.236);padding:3px;display:-ms-flexbox;display:flex;-ms-flex-pack:space-evenly;justify-content:space-evenly;-ms-flex-align:center;align-items:center}.popover-content .content-item[data-v-34444dd2]:first-child{border-top:none}.popover-content .content-item[data-v-34444dd2] .el-button{padding:5px}.card-container[data-v-25df7c62]{display:-ms-flexbox;display:flex;padding:16px 18px;width:600px;height:500px;background:#fff;box-shadow:0 4px 5px 0 #eef2f5;border-radius:8px;box-sizing:border-box;cursor:pointer;transition:box-shadow .2s linear}.card-pic[data-v-25df7c62]{-ms-flex-negative:0;flex-shrink:0;width:150px;background:#eee;border-radius:6px;overflow:hidden}.card-pic>img[data-v-25df7c62]{object-fit:cover;height:100%;width:100%}.course-detail[data-v-25df7c62]{margin-left:22px;padding-right:22px;-ms-flex:1;flex:1;overflow:hidden}.course-title[data-v-25df7c62]{font-size:20px;font-weight:500;color:#4c4c4c;line-height:28px;cursor:pointer;transition:color .2s ease;text-overflow:ellipsis;overflow:hidden;white-space:nowrap}.course-desc[data-v-25df7c62]{margin-top:10px;font-size:16px;font-weight:300;color:#888;line-height:23px;height:275px;padding:0 8px;line-height:26px;background:#f2f3f6;border-radius:3px;box-sizing:border-box;text-overflow:ellipsis;overflow:hidden;white-space:nowrap}.course-price[data-v-25df7c62]{margin-top:10px}.course-price[data-v-25df7c62] .el-radio-group>label{display:block;margin:5px}.course-price .price[data-v-25df7c62]{display:inline-block;margin-left:20px}.set-other-btn[data-v-25df7c62]{color:#fff;background-color:#f88603;border-color:#f88603}.set-other-btn[data-v-25df7c62]:focus,.set-other-btn[data-v-25df7c62]:hover{background-color:#0375f8;border-color:#0375f8}.info-bottom[data-v-25df7c62]{display:-ms-flexbox;display:flex;-ms-flex-pack:end;justify-content:end;margin-top:0}.bg[data-v-ccce68fe]{width:100%;height:100%;background:url(../img/subjectBg.a1e0561e.png) no-repeat;background-color:#010546;background-size:cover}.tabs-container[data-v-ccce68fe]{padding:150px 10px 0 10px;display:-ms-flexbox;display:flex;-ms-flex-pack:center;justify-content:center}.course-container[data-v-ccce68fe]{display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:70px 0;-ms-flex-pack:space-evenly;justify-content:space-evenly}[data-v-ccce68fe] .el-tabs__content{padding:1px}[data-v-ccce68fe] .tabs-container .el-tabs__nav{border-color:transparent}[data-v-ccce68fe] .tabs-container .el-tabs__nav-scroll{display:-ms-flexbox;display:flex;-ms-flex-pack:center;justify-content:center}[data-v-ccce68fe] .tabs-container .el-tabs--card>.el-tabs__header{border-bottom-color:transparent}[data-v-ccce68fe] .tabs-container .el-tabs .el-tabs__header .el-tabs__item.is-active{background:#347bf7;color:#fff}[data-v-ccce68fe] .tabs-container .el-tabs .el-tabs__header .el-tabs__item{background:#fff;color:#347bf7;border-radius:10px;border:none;margin-right:10px;height:30px;line-height:30px}